Output ef8c82264567a0b896824a516c8c2111fc130d878b44b8cf2f9f9ad5df3f36fb:2

value
512943
script pubkey
OP_0 OP_PUSHBYTES_32 326a738d773a443b962be9cd4719d46bc5aa04df82541cc3e17f4aabdf1c09e7
address
bc1qxf488rth8fzrh93ta8x5wxw5d0z65pxlsf2peslp0a92hhcup8ns993er0
transaction
ef8c82264567a0b896824a516c8c2111fc130d878b44b8cf2f9f9ad5df3f36fb
confirmations
45788
spent
true